Later model Jeeps have anti-rollover valves which essentially makes them "siphon proof". Like most, if not all late model cars, they also have plastic fuel tanks which are easily punctured if somebody really wants your gas. I have an all steel, completely surronding skidplate on my tank, but I've heard of it happening to others. Late model pastic tanks sure aren't cheap like the aftermarket steel Mustang tanks.
